Handover: Ladleworks recipe-scaling calculator. Scaling factors are validated server-side; the client-supplied multiplier is clamped to 0.1–50 to prevent integer-overflow tricks in the nutrition summary. Unit conversions route through a single audited table — please review the new imperial entries carefully, as they touch parsing of free-text quantities. Security questions raised during review should be addressed to the engineer named below.

named custodian: Brivan Eliath Quenox Frador

Facilities ticket — Halewick Tower, night shift.

Issue: support team reporting east stairwell reader rejecting badges after midnight. Reader was reset this morning; firmware updated. Overnight crew should now badge as normal. If the reader fails again, use the manual keypad by the fire door — do not prop the door. Log any further failures with the time and badge name. Temporary keypad code for the fallback door is below.

door code, tajeg-fawip: bdg-K-62

Handover Note — Weekend Lift Maintenance, Verrick Tower

Hi Dana, taking over from me for the weekend: Corliss Lifts are servicing cars 2 and 3 from Saturday 07:00 through Sunday afternoon. Car 1 stays in service for staff and deliveries. The engineers will sign in at the facilities desk and need escorting to the motor room on Level 9. Keep the goods lift locked off unless the engineers request it. The motor room door is on the keypad system, so give the engineers the access code below.

staff pass of haweg-bafop = bdg-G-69